Unicode Crypter is an encryption software that converts plain text into Unicode text to prevent unauthorized access. It encrypts text by converting it into Unicode format which appears scrambled.
Ensafer is a cloud-based safety management software designed for construction and industrial companies. It helps streamline safety workflows, manage incident reporting, conduct inspections and observations, deliver safety training, perform safety program reviews, and analyze trends to prevent injuries or accidents.
